Midstate01;1632145 wrote:Green can't change teams again now right. I feel stupid asking because I'm pretty sure he can't. But I want to be sure.
He couldnt before this game.

Once you play a game for the Senior Team in an international game, you are tied to them. You can play in the youth teams and still change (We have a few of those guys).

Midstate01;1632148 wrote:Yea I didn't mean to imply because of today..just in general. But thanks, I was pretty sure he couldn't, just was hoping for confirmation.
No problem. Klinsmann has pretty much played guys who have duel citizenship immediately once Fifa clears them to tie them down. Not that he is the only one, but its smart. AJ, Green, Johnson could all have played elswhere. Green and Johnson were wanted by Germany...Jurgen was smart, especially in the case of Green. Germany wouldnt use him for at least 4 more years, but the USMNT has room for him, even at 19, so he sells him that. The chance to play for the US now outweighs the possibility to play for Germany...because you never know if you will end up good enough to be a regular for a squad like that (looking at you, Guiseppi Rossi...).

Hopefully Green turns out to be as good as we think and makes this move even better...aka...the Germans wishing Green was with them.
